Supreme court directed the State of Chhatisgarh to file a report about reason for over detention of a convict and other similar prisoners to punish the State. After hearing A.Sirajudeen, senior advocate, the Supreme Court observed that the State has to be punished for such over detention and directed the State Government to file a report in this regard and also other cases of over detention and adjourned the case by four weeks.
